September 15 2025 Tithi – Panchang – Hindu Calendar – Good Time – Nakshatra – Rashi

Tithi in Panchang – Hindu Calendar on Monday, September 15 2025 – It is Krishna Paksha Ashtami and Navami tithi or the eighth and ninth day during the waning or dark phase of moon in Hindu calendar and Panchang in most regions. It is Krishna Paksha Ashtami tithi or the eighth day during the waning or dark phase of moon till 6:26 AM on September 15. Then onward it is Krishna Paksha Navami tithi or the ninth day during the waning or dark phase of moon till 4:24 AM on September 16. (Time applicable in all north, south and eastern parts of India. All time based on India Standard Time.) 

Good – Auspicious time on September 15, 2025 as per Hindu Calendar – There is no good and auspicious time on the entire day. 

Nakshatra – Mrigasira or Makayiram or Mrigasheersham nakshatra till 11:32 AM on September 15. Then onward it is Ardra or Arudhara or Thiruvathira nakshatra till 10:19 AM on September 16. (Time applicable in north, south and eastern parts of India). 

In western parts of India (Maharashtra, Gujarat, Goa, north Karnataka and south Rajasthan), Mrigasira or Makayiram or Mrigasheersham nakshatra till 7:31 AM on September 15. Then onward it is Ardra or Arudhara or Thiruvathira nakshatra till 6:46 AM on September 16. 

Rashi or Moon Sign – Vrishabha Rashi till 12:15 AM on September 15. Then onward it is Mithuna Rashi till 3:39 AM on September 17, 2025. (Time applicable in all north, south and eastern parts of India.) 

In western parts of India (Maharashtra, Gujarat, Goa and south Rajasthan) - Vrishabha Rashi till 8:03 PM on September 14. Then onward it is Mithuna Rashi till 12:28 AM on September 17, 2025.   

Festivals, Vrat and Auspicious days – Matru Navami – Avidhava Navami
